Brief summary
The purpose of this pilot study is to determine whether obese adults,obese (BMI\>30 kg/m2) with obesity hypoventilation or obese COPD-patients do undergo oxygen desaturation under flight simulation and if the hypoxic altitude simulation test is as effective as the hypoxic chamber test.

Eligibility
Inclusion criteria
* age ≥ 18 years * patients with COPD (GOLD I-IV Group A-D) with obesity (BMI\> 30kg/m2), obese healthy adults with BMI\> 30kg /m2, patients with Obesity hypoventilation syndrome * informed consent provided
Exclusion criteria
* patients less than BMI \<30 kg/m2 with or without COPD, OHS * Age \< 18 years * pregnancy, lactation * any medical, psychological or other condition restricting the patient's ability to provide informed consent * participation in another clinical trial
